This study presents a synoptic literary analysis of several of the Qur'an's variant traditions to illuminate the complex redactional processes that shaped its final form. The research employs a historical-critical approach, particularly redaction criticism, with a keen focus on the specific literary and grammatical features as key markers for identifying editorial interventions and alterations within these traditions. The following analysis advances the study of the Qur'an's variant traditions by introducing a unique redaction-critical methodology by providing a systematic framework to analyze textual relationships, grammatical shifts, and thematic coherence, and identifying markers of redactional work. Crucially, it redefines the role of Qur'anic redactors not merely as collectors, but as shapers and authors who imbued the text with their own theological conceptions and distinct outlooks. This research challenges the view of the Qur'an as a single, linear text, instead revealing it as a complex product of literary, textual, and theological influences, with internal variations stemming from its intricate history
